Output dca565bf6f3ccbb8125d9d892828b226e6c139dcc547cd5d8b23afbb7736f421:12

value
389113675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40243c2fd55e69d3f0c42c0f869a51af545890c8 OP_EQUAL
address
37YAaUoPsM7iQGMkCXS6fJY2YYhiY3R6Gw
transaction
dca565bf6f3ccbb8125d9d892828b226e6c139dcc547cd5d8b23afbb7736f421
spent
true